Key Responsibilities and Work Coordination

The WPR is responsible for receiving, reviewing, and managing work permits in accordance with applicable project procedures. Before work begins, the employee must understand the permit conditions and ensure that the assigned team is aware of the required controls and limitations. The position also involves coordinating with supervisors and other responsible personnel when work conditions change or additional precautions are required. A WPR must maintain awareness of the work area and ensure that activities remain within the approved scope of the permit. Proper communication, documentation, and compliance with site safety requirements are essential parts of the role, particularly in an active industrial project environment.
